(a) A falconer shall maintain complete and accurate records for each raptor that identify:
- (1) the species, sex, age, and lineage;
- (2) the date of acquisition;
- (3) the date of the death, loss, release, or transfer to another person of each raptor and an explanation of the reasons therefore; and, (4) if applicable, the name, address, and permit number of persons who previously possessed the raptor, and date of transfer.
- (b) The records required in subsection (a) of this section shall be maintained in chronological order, retained for a minimum of five years after the date of death, loss, or transfer of any raptor possessed by a falconer and shall be available for inspection at any reasonable time upon request of the commissioner or the commissioner’s duly designated agent.
